Created to support and address children's social-emotional skills, The Feels Educators' Edition helps students learn how to identify 5 major emotional states as well as strategies for taking care of their feelings. With time, practicing the skills offered in The Feels encourages collaboration instead of combativeness with emotions, teaching children to listen without judgment to what our feelings have to say so we can decide the best course of action to take. This curriculum will support students with emotion identification, emotional regulation, Mindfulness, and Collaborative Problem Solving.

The Feels curriculum introduces students to each of the six Social Emotional Learning Standards set forth by Washington State, touching on benchmarks and indicators using an engaging narrative and supplemental learning tools that can be accessed continuously within the classroom to further reinforce learning.
